Welcome to St John of God Health Care

St John of God Health Care is one of the largest private providers of health care services in Australia, employing more than 16,000 employees (caregivers). We operate 26 hospitals and services comprising more than 3,300 hospital beds, including home nursing, disability services and social outreach programs.

As a Catholic, not-for-profit group, we invest all profits to the communities we serve by updating and expanding our facilities and technology; expanding existing services and developing and acquiring new services; and providing Social Outreach services to people experiencing disadvantage to improve health and wellbeing.

St John of God Bendigo Hospital is a 122-bed contemporary private hospital located in central Victoria providing high quality acute medical and surgical health care services for people in Bendigo and surrounding areas.
